Angry 1st run against a 9 second car

First run against a 9 second car. Blue S10 truck. Dialed 9.69. My dial was 11.96. My car wasn't running 100% but hey dial what your car is running.

His------------------------Mine
RT .002 -----------RT .022
1/4 9.689----------------1/4 11.959
MPH 138-----------------MPH 113:

Breakouts
His .001-----------------Mine .001

His MOV .0202 (The .020 I gave him on the tree)

I though I had the stripe by a wheel, I lost it by a fender and didn't have time to hit the breaks. I am totally amazed by how fast he came by at the end of the track.

Write this one off to experience.
